The best-known street in the Zurenborg district is the Cogels-Osylei, in the Berchem area, which is well known for its art-nouveau architecture. The most important square in the centre of the district is the Dageraadplaats, almost completely surrounded by cafés and restaurants and on sunny days forms one big terrace!

The southern district in Antwerp is usually called Het Zuid (or in short: 't Zuid). Because of the many bars, restaurants and cafés, it is known as a trendy neighbourhood. The district owes its name to the Royal Museum of Fine Arts, the Museum of Contemporary Art Antwerp (Mukha) and the Photography Museum. In addition, the new courthouse, the Zuiderpershuis, the Sint-Michiel and Sint-Petrus churches and the modernist Sint-Walburgis church are located here. There are also many large stately mansions and graceful art nouveau houses in the district. Definitely have a drink at Marnix plaats :)

Het Eilandje ("the island") has not stolen its name: Antwerp's oldest port area is surrounded by water. Today, port activity is more concentrated in the north, but the port feeling still prevails here. Taste the old atmosphere of the unloading quay with monumental warehouses, lanterns, hangars and cobblestones. Thanks to three crowd-pullers, the MAS | Museum aan de Stroom, the Red Star Line Museum (really worth a visit) and the Port House, the link between the city and the water is underlined once more.

The immensely beautiful Rococo buildings on the Meir house major European chain stores. It makes this traffic-free boulevard the pre-eminent hotspot for every shopaholic. Meir hosts the bigger-brands stores, try some streets with local and smaller fashion shops nearby : kammenstraat, nationalestraat, Korte Gasthuisstraat, Wiegstraat and Lombardenvest.

The old city centre is steeped in history. You will find it in ancient building-fronts on narrow streets or in the imposing Grand-Place. The Plantin-Moretus Museum is the only museum in the world to be classified as a Unesco World Heritage site. In the shadow of the Cathedral of Our Lady, the city teems with life in intimate pubs and restaurants. The banks of the Scheldt are a great place for a breath of fresh air.
